    Default Hood Release 95 Disco

    Hi All
    I'm new, just bought a 95 Disco, been sitting up since...2004! Any way after cleaning the cob webs and a few dirt dobber nests, I tried to pop the hood (it was opened by the previous owner before i bought it) and i cannot open it...i can't pull it so that the lock pops. I don't want to break anything, but I need to get this fixed for sure...anyone have any suggestions?

    Default

    Sounds like it needs a new cable... pull the wire with vice grips and plan to buy a new cable.

    Default

    Quote Originally Posted by Joey4420
    ... pull the wire with vice grips ...
    Once it's open, give the works a severe soaking of penetrating oil. Get the latch and into the sheath of the hood release cable. Work it with the vice grips, soak it again, let it sit.

    It may loosen it up enough to operate reliably.
